Deadline Day: Maple Leafs claim Gerber, Reitz

The Toronto Maple Leafs on Wednesday claimed goaltender Martin Gerber off waivers from the Ottawa Senators and defenseman Erik Reitz from the New York Rangers. Deadline Day: QC rookie Wilson part of deal to Colorado

The Colorado Avalanche, parent club of the AHL’s Lake Erie Monsters, announced today that the team has acquired defensemen Lawrence Nycholat and Ryan Wilson, along with a second-round pick in the 2009 NHL Entry Draft (originally Montreal’s choice), from the Calgary Flames. Deadline Day: Blues, Pens swap AHL defensemen

The St. Louis Blues, parent club of the AHL’s Peoria Rivermen, announced today the club has acquired defenseman Danny Richmond from the Pittsburgh Penguins, parent club of the AHL’s Wilkes-Barre/Scranton Penguins, in exchange for defenseman Andy Wozniewski. Norfolk cools off Sound Tigers with 3-1 triumph

NORFOLK 3, BRIDGEPORT 1 The Norfolk Admirals halted Bridgeport’s points streak at 11 games (8-0-0-3) with a 3-1 road victory over the Sound Tigers on Tuesday. AHL releases 2008-09 Top Prospects card set

SPRINGFIELD, Mass. … The American Hockey League and the Professional Hockey Players’ Association today unveiled the 2008-09 AHL Top Prospects trading card set, featuring 50 of the outstanding young players in the AHL. Chipchura returns to Bulldogs

Montreal Canadiens general manager Bob Gainey announced today that forward Kyle Chipchura has been assigned from the Canadiens to the Hamilton Bulldogs of the American Hockey League. Helminen recalled by Hurricanes

The Albany River Rats announced today that center Dwight Helminen has been recalled by the Carolina Hurricanes, their National Hockey League affiliate. Helminen, 25, was recalled to Carolina on an emergency recall after Hurricanes forward Jussi Jokinen recently returned to Finland following the death of his father. Rangers claim Avery off waivers from Dallas

New York Rangers President and General Manager Glen Sather announced today that the club has acquired forward Sean Avery off re-entry waivers from the Dallas Stars.
